Outils pour utilisateurs

Outils du site


informatique:langages:css:alignement_vertical

Différences

Ci-dessous, les différences entre deux révisions de la page.

Lien vers cette vue comparative

Les deux révisions précédentesRévision précédente
informatique:langages:css:alignement_vertical [2025/01/02 09:28] – supprimée - modification externe (Date inconnue) 127.0.0.1informatique:langages:css:alignement_vertical [2025/01/02 09:28] (Version actuelle) – ↷ Page déplacée de informatique:css:alignement_vertical à informatique:langages:css:alignement_vertical alexis
Ligne 1: Ligne 1:
 +====== Alignement vertical ======
 +Si on veut aligner du texte et une image dans une cellule, il faut utiliser la propriété //[[https://developer.mozilla.org/en-US/docs/Web/CSS/vertical-align|vertical-align]]//.\\
 +Cependant, il faut faire attention de l'appliquer au bon élément. Instinctivement, on voudrait l'appliquer au contenant (la cellule), alors que c'est au contenu (le texte et l'image).
 +
 +Voici les citations de [[http://forum.alsacreations.com/topic.php?fid=4&tid=35#p4653|ce message]] qui m'ont aidé à comprendre ce fonctionnement :
 +> S'applique à : ceux des éléments de type en-ligne et à l'élément 'table-cell'.
 +
 +> Cette propriété agit sur le positionnement vertical à l'intérieur de la boîte de ligne des boîtes générées par un élément de type en-ligne. Les règles suivantes n'ont de sens que par rapport à un élément parent de type en-ligne, ou de type bloc si celui-ci génère des boîtes en-ligne anonymes ; elles sont inopérantes autrement.
 +> Note : la signification des valeurs pour cette propriété est légèrement différente dans le contexte des tables. Consulter le chapitre traitant des algorithmes pour la hauteur des tables pour le détail.